OK, I was sitting at my desk at work, drinking my coffee and waiting for work to start (I always get here early). I did not bring my book today (oops!) so I picked up the dictionary (Gadzooks! I'm such a geek) and opened it up. It landed on the page with pictures of 20 different Heraldic Crosses.
A lot of these looked like they would be perfect for crossbow variations and easily created in the VFX editor.
Some with great names and cool appearances were: The Fourchee (each arm forked, maybe shoot 2 bolts?) The Botonee (a cluster of balls at the end of each arm) The Avellan (Filberts on ends {those're the things on Queens heads in cheap plastic chess sets) The Tau Cross(bow) (A stylized T shape)
Some ones that looked great, but had crappy names, were: The Lorraine Cross(bow) (A cross piece at bottom as well as top) The Fleury (Flowery ends)
Some that looked crappy but had cool names were: The Quadrate Cross(bow) The Potent Cross(bow)
I've never seen anyone work real Heraldry references in to a game before. A little research can make your effort unique! Heraldry was, after all, a very important part of historic "Heroes" lives.
